Reuters reports that B&G Foods Inc plans on raising list prices for the first time in three years and curb promotions. The food maker is known for its breakfast staple Cream of Wheat and snack brand Pirate's Booty.

The rise in prices will cover the cost of increased in freight. A B&G spokesperson said that freight costs ate into its 2017 income. So far, the prices will be raised about a dime. 

B&G doesn't see the end of increased freight costs ending anytime soon, but strongly believes that the hike in prices will be able to cover the cost. The company has also seen the price of making canned good rise due to the new tariffs the Trump Administration have put on steel and aluminum, Reuters reports.

The company doesn't anticipate any further price increases this year.
